I have a Honda Odyessy that has a wicked shimmy in my steering wheel. I've been living with it for some time and after my last road 11hr road trip,the shimmy has to go.I've had my normal mechanic static balance and do alignment work. Each time yup Mr Sapochetti its fixed.As soon as I get the tires warmed upped the shimmy comes back. It has come to the point were I told him to take the car home and drive the car to see what the shimmy is like and I don't want it back until its fixed.Its driving me effn nuts.The shimmy comes and goes and it starts around 55 to 70mph.I did do some research and most of the time they are saying do a "road force balance"
What is it and why isn't a static balance enough?

road force balancing is a method of measuring a tires runout under loaded conditions. it'll usually uncover a seperated tire that can get by a visual and/or dynamic (you want dynamic, not static) balance.

it sounds like you have a bad tire, a road force test wouldnt be a bad idea.

My store installs tires for a honda used car dealer........all the hondas they send us (other then odyessy's) get cheap no name brand tires. But ALL the odyessy's get top of the line GoodYear's or Michelins. These vans are so freaking sensitive to tires its unreal. We were installing good coopers and mastercraft tires on them but they kept coming back with vibrations like you describe. Once we started installing the top of the line tires the comebacks went away. On these vans even a .002-.004 out of round tire is easily felt while driving.

Goodyear tire spec on out of round tires qaulifying for adjustment must be of .004 or more of up/down movement in the tread to even be considered.

A road force balance is a balancer that applies pressure to the tire while it is spun while balancing to simulate the tire being on the road under a car. Check the tires for seperation and bulges. or there might be something in the tire like water ect ect. Ask you shop to zero them out not just slap the wieghts on.

A static balance is where they only place a weight on the inside of the rim so it doesn't show on the outside, dynamic is placing weights to balance both sides not just one big one to compensate for both.
